New Book 'The Structure of Revelation' Presents Mathematical Blueprint for Biblical Prophecy

The release of 'The Structure of Revelation' by Dean McMullen presents a significant contribution to biblical scholarship by reframing the Book of Revelation as a perfectly ordered, mathematically structured blueprint authored by God. This work matters because it provides a clear, logical perspective on prophecy grounded directly in Scripture, offering readers an unprecedented analytical framework that could reshape how biblical prophecy is understood and studied.

McMullen's journey toward this discovery began during his unexpected deployment to the Gulf War, an experience that would later collide with prophecy when he encountered an interpretation linking the Gulf War to the Fifth Trumpet in the Book of Revelation. Through rigorous study, he examined thirteen prophetic indicators and found each one aligned precisely with the events he had lived through, a revelation that became the catalyst for years of research and ultimately laid the foundation for this groundbreaking book.

The book's importance lies in its unique prophetic roadmap that aligns Daniel's 70 Weeks with the seals, voices, trumpets, and vials in exact sequence. McMullen explains the Four Horsemen as active global belief systems, presents a clear, structured analysis of the Rapture through the Sixth Seal, and identifies the 144,000 as the scriptural 'firstfruits' of redemption. Through compelling narrative, visual charts, and accessible teaching, the book demonstrates that every prophetic detail—including days, months, years, and even the 'space of half an hour'—fits into a flawless divine structure.

The implications of this work extend to both religious scholarship and personal faith. For scholars, it offers a new analytical framework that combines military discipline with academic precision, potentially influencing how biblical texts are studied and interpreted. For individual readers, it provides a structured approach to understanding complex prophetic texts that many find challenging to navigate. 'This book is not a new doctrine,' McMullen states. 'It is simply taking the Bible for what it says and allowing its perfect timeline to speak for itself.'
